Find the Next Term 4 , 8 , 16 , 32 , 64
4 , 8 , 16 , 32 , 64
Step 1
This is a geometric sequence since there is a common ratio between each term. In this case, multiplying the previous term in the sequence by 2 gives the next term. In other words, an=a1rn-1.
Geometric Sequence: r=2
Step 2
This is the form of a geometric sequence.
an=a1rn-1
Step 3
Substitute in the values of a1=4 and r=2.
an=42n-1
Step 4
Multiply 42n-1.

Step 4.1
Rewrite 4 as 22.
an=222n-1
Step 4.2
Use the power rule aman=am+n to combine exponents.
an=22+n-1
Step 4.3
Subtract 1 from 2.
an=2n+1
an=2n+1
Step 5
Substitute in the value of n to find the nth term.
a6=2(6)+1
Step 6
Add 6 and 1.
a6=27
Step 7
Raise 2 to the power of 7.
a6=128
